Hans Peter MAY was born in 1660 in Niederhausen a.d. Appel, Pfalz(D), the child of Hans Peter May And Maria Magdalena Niess Nyce. Hans Peter MAY married Anna Elisabetha Apolonia Schwarh, and had children including Christoffel May. Hans Peter MAY passed away in 1724 in Krümse, Harburg, Niedersachsen, Germany.
